Medical Solutions acquires San Diego-based Host Healthcare

Medical Solutions acquired San Diego-based healthcare staffing firm Host Healthcare in a deal that closed Oct. 31.

Medical Solutions, based in Omaha, Nebraska, ranks as the third-largest US provider of travel nurses, while Host Healthcare ranks as the 17th largest.

“The timing was right for both of our organizations to align,” Medical Solutions CEO Craig Meier said. “The synergy that will evolve from leveraging the strengths of both companies will expand our market share and allow us to fulfill the rapidly growing needs of new and existing clients. The industry as a whole will benefit as we infuse more resources into the healthcare system pipeline.”

Plans call for the Host brand to remain.

Host Healthcare and focuses on nurse, allied and therapy staffing. This year, it ranked No. 15 on the Fastest-Growing US Staffing Firms list with $404.8 million in 2021 revenue. It was founded in 2012 by Adam Francis, who is CEO.

“Our Host Healthcare brand and company was built on trust, mutual respect, and strong values,” Francis said. “The foundation at Medical Solutions is built upon these same principles. Our travelers, customers and employees will all benefit from this acquisition, and I’m thrilled to be able to bring this opportunity to them.”

Francis will remain with the company.

Terms of the transaction were not announced.
